AWD is useless until it's below freezing with black ice and snow. When I still lived in NY, having AWD was a game changer. I would see cars struggling in the snow to blow right past them. Winter tires can only do so much. However if you're not in a climate that has a lot of cold weather and snow it's mostly a waste of money. (Super Ded fkn Srs)

Floridacel here. 4wd comes in handy here for traversing flooded roads (happens any time theres heavy rain), driving in sand (the best surfing and fishing spots in my county are best accessed by driving on the beach), and not having your suspension destroyed driving through our potholed roads (thats more ground clearance but anyways).
99.999% of people may not need it but its nice to have.

If you live in a area where they plow and salt the streets then you can get by fine with all seasons.
And along the coast it barely snows but a few times a year.
